Axiom provides unlimited log ingestion with query-on-read architecture. No indexes, no storage limits at the tier level. Modern alternative to Elastic and Datadog Logs.

SGLang provides fast LLM serving with RadixAttention for prefix caching, constrained decoding, and a flexible frontend language. Competitive performance with vLLM.
